Transaction 20b39f7e156dbc77d20c13b54d29bc6845962fe4dc33049846eb573208621fd7
1 Input
1 Output
-
20b39f7e156dbc77d20c13b54d29bc6845962fe4dc33049846eb573208621fd7:0
- value
- 56670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f064f8553c31275bba390d412b95ba58aebfbeb OP_EQUAL
- address
- 3Bp4VJmD8SFj3QEkoeQQzyzBgEQEcc6ibt